Explore our range of floribunda roses, including varieties like flower carpet roses, Helga, and more. Floribunda roses produce an abundance of flowers that typically grow in a bushy form and in clusters. They are hardier and more disease-resistant than other roses, making them an excellent choice for garden beds.

Rosa 'Flower Carpet White' is a superb ground cover rose that combines elegant white blooms with exceptional reliability. Producing masses of single to semi-double pure white flowers with soft golden centres, it flowers continuously from early summer until the first frosts.
Renowned for its excellent disease resistance and low-maintenance nature, this award-winning rose is ideal for covering banks, borders, large beds, or creating a long-lasting flowering carpet of colour. The open flowers are also highly attractive to pollinators.
